I have 4 servers -- two of which are DC's. The other two
are file servers. I am successfully able to log on to the
file servers with the admin account for the domain. When
I try to log on to either of the DC's, I get the following
error:

"RegLoadKey failed. Return value The system has attempted
to load or restore a file into the registry, but the
specified file is not in a registry file format. for
C:\Documents and Settings\administrator.DOMAIN\ntuser.dat."

Any suggestions on how to repair/fix?

You need to restore the file : ntuser.dat.that was in the administrators
profile from backup
